Android разработчик
генерация резюме под вакансию
сопроводительное письмо
описание
Free V*N Planet is a cybersecurity company that provides privacy and security solutions, focusing on protecting digital lives and ensuring anonymity for users worldwide.
задачи
- Design and implement Android features using Kotlin and Jetpack Compose;
- Maintain and improve multi-module application architecture;
- Work with local databases, caching, offline-first logic, and data synchronization;
- Integrate backend APIs and handle complex networking scenarios;
- Build reliable background services and long-running processes;
- Improve app performance, stability, startup time, and memory usage;
- Participate in architectural decisions and technical planning;
- Review code, mentor other developers, and maintain engineering standards;
- Write and maintain tests for critical business logic;
- Collaborate with backend, QA, product, and design teams;
- Prepare production releases and support post-release monitoring.
требования
- Strong Kotlin knowledge;
- Solid experience with Jetpack Compose;
- Experience with multi-module Android architecture;
- Good understanding of Clean Architecture, MVVM/MVI, SOLID, and dependency inversion;
- Experience with Room, DataStore, SQL, migrations, and local persistence;
- Experience with Coroutines, Flow, StateFlow, SharedFlow, and structured concurrency;
- Experience with Retrofit, Ktor, OkHttp, WebSockets, REST APIs, and background networking;
- Strong knowledge of Android lifecycle, background work, foreground services, WorkManager, and permissions;
- Experience with Hilt/Koin or other DI frameworks;
- Experience with Gradle, version catalogs, build flavors, CI/CD, and release builds;
- Ability to write unit tests and UI tests;
- Understanding of app performance, memory management, ANR prevention, and profiling tools;
- Confident Git usage and code review experience;
- Intermediate+ English for technical documentation and communication;
- Nice to have: Experience with V*N applications or Android VPN Service, understanding of TCP/IP, UDP, DNS, TLS, HTTP/2, HTTP/3, QUIC, SOCKS, and proxy protocols, experience with Xray, V2Ray, WireGuard, OpenVPN, Shadowsocks, or similar technologies, understanding of traffic routing, tunneling, packet processing, split tunneling, and network diagnostics, experience with native libraries, JNI, NDK, or Go/Rust/C++ integration, experience with security-sensitive applications, knowledge of Play Billing, subscriptions, Firebase, Remote Config, Crashlytics, Analytics, and A/B testing, experience with Kotlin Multiplatform Mobile, experience with large-scale apps, modularization, and complex build systems.
условия
- Build personal AI agents using premium infrastructure;
- Absolute freedom to work from any location (GMT+1– GMT+4);
- Internal R&D opportunities;
- Paid time off and sick leave;
- Direct impact on a massive, world-class B2C product;
- A collaborative environment with some of the best minds;
- Hardware upon completion of your probation.
навыки
Если просят войти через iCloud, отправить коды из SMS, запустить код, что-то установить, перевести деньги или сделать что угодно, связанное с деньгами, не соглашайтесь: это признаки мошенничества.